S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

Daem0nMCP users need a disciplined protocol to engage memory tools, ensuring briefing, preflight checks, memory inscription, and outcome reflection are consistently performed to reduce memory leaks, miscoordination, and reckless changes.

Core Features & Use Cases

  • Enforces a session lifecycle: commune briefing, preflight consulting, decision inscription, and outcome reflection.
  • Provides hard enforcement barriers and remedies for skipped steps to improve compliance.
  • Enables structured governance of AI actions when Daem0nMCP tools are available, ensuring traceable decisions and learnings.
